personal-website/assets/script/app.js

20 lines
597 B
JavaScript
Raw Normal View History

2018-07-28 01:15:46 -04:00
var $document = $(document),
$nav = $('.navbar-top'),
2018-07-28 01:15:46 -04:00
navbarDef = 'bg-dark',
effect = 'fadeInDown';
if (window.location.pathname ==='/') {
$document.scroll(function() {
//if >100 pixels have been scrolled
if ($document.scrollTop() >= 100) {
$nav.addClass(navbarDef);
$nav.addClass(effect); //add animation effect
} else {
$nav.removeClass(navbarDef);
$nav.removeClass(effect); //add animation effect
}
});
} else {
$nav.addClass(navbarDef);
$nav.addClass(effect); //add animation effect
}